Native range 9 botanical countries

Regions where Cnidium cnidiifolium is native: Kamchatka, Khabarovsk, Krasnoyarsk, Magadan, Yakutiya, Alaska, British Columbia, Northwest Territories, Yukon KamchatkaKhabarovskKrasnoyarskMagadanYakutiyaAlaskaBritish ColumbiaNorthwest TerritoriesYukon
Native distribution of Cnidium cnidiifolium, after Kew’s World Checklist of Vascular Plants. Introduced, extinct and doubtful records are excluded, so this is where the plant is from, not everywhere it now grows.

Also published as 2 synonyms

A synonym is not an error. It is a record of botanists disagreeing, in print, about where this plant belongs. Each of these was somebody’s considered answer.

  • Conioselinum cnidiifolium (Turcz.) A.E.Porsild
  • Selinum cnidiifolium Turcz.
